Housing program manager gender statistics
65.3% of housing program managers are women and 34.7% of housing program managers are men.
- Female, 65.3%
- Male, 34.7%

Housing program manager gender pay gap
Women earn 95¢ for every $1 earned by men
Male income
$42,827
Female income
$40,776

Housing program manager dem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among housing program managers is White, which makes up 62.0% of all housing program managers. Comparatively, 14.6% of housing program managers are Hispanic or Latino and 11.9% of housing program managers are Black or African American.
- White, 62.0%
- Hispanic or Latino, 14.6%
- Black or African American, 11.9%
- Unknown, 5.4%
- Asian, 5.2%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 0.9%

Housing program manager educational attainment
The most common degree for housing program managers is bachelor's degree, with 57% of housing program managers earning that degree. The second and third most common degree levels are master's degree degree at 24% and master's degree degree at 11%.
- Bachelor's, 57%
- Master's, 24%
- Associate, 11%
- High School Diploma, 4%
- Other Degrees, 4%

Housing program manager wage gap by degree level
According to the data, housing program managers with a Doctorate degree earn more than those without, at $52,970 annually. With a Master's degree, housing program managers earn a median annual income of $49,734 compared to $42,643 for housing program managers with an Bachelor's degree.
| Education | Salary |
|---|---|
| Master's Degree | $49,734 |
| Bachelor's Degree | $42,643 |
| Doctorate Degree | $52,970 |
